Renovations recently began on the White House in Washington, D.C., as the building’s East Wing was demolished to make way for the construction of a new ballroom. This ambitious project is being funded by former President Donald Trump along with a group of corporate donors.
The White House has recently disclosed the full list of companies and individuals financially supporting the new ballroom, as reported by CNBC. Notably, several of the biggest names in the tech industry are contributing to the project. Among the prominent companies are Apple, Google, Amazon, Microsoft, and Meta.
The complete list of donors includes:
**Corporate Donors:**
– Altria Group Inc.
– Amazon
– Apple
– Booz Allen Hamilton Inc.
– Caterpillar Inc.
– Coinbase
– Comcast Corporation
– J. Pepe and Emilia Fanjul
– Hard Rock International
– Google
– HP Inc.
– Lockheed Martin
– Meta Platforms
– Micron Technology
– Microsoft
– NextEra Energy Inc.
– Palantir Technologies Inc.
– Ripple
– Reynolds American
– T-Mobile
– Tether America
– Union Pacific Railroad
**Individual and Family Donors:**
– Adelson Family Foundation
– Stefan E. Brodie
– Betty Wold Johnson Foundation
– Charles and Marissa Cascarilla
– Edward and Shari Glazer
– Harold Hamm
– Benjamin Leon Jr.
– The Lutnick Family
– The Laura & Isaac Perlmutter Foundation
– Stephen A. Schwarzmann
– Konstantin Sokolov
– Kelly Loeffler and Jeff Sprecher
– Paolo Tiramani
– Cameron Winklevoss
– Tyler Winklevoss
